My baby beardie, Ichi, suddenly seems so fat today.
He pooped a normal looking poop this morning, so I know he's not constipated or impacted. He ate today, just less insects than usual. He gets salad in the morning, BSFs at lunchtime, and dubias at dinner. He left quite a bit of leftover BSFs today, which is a bit odd, but his salad is pretty much gone lol. He drank a couple of water drops from his syringe, but overall wasn't too interested in drinking. Here's a picture I took of him on his cool-side hammock as it's almost bed-time in an hour.
Look at that belly!! Is it normal for baby beardies to look fat while they're growing, especially so suddenly? Set-up is a 20L tank with a Reptisun T5 10.0 in the reflective reptisun hood on top of the screen. Basking spot 6" away. Paper towel substrate. Hot spot is 110F on a dimmer lamp, 75 watt bulb. Humidity 36%.
